General Public•G Job Duties The Certified Medical Assistant provides clinical and administrative support to ensure efficient operations within the healthcare setting. This role is responsible for direct patient care tasks, assisting medical providers, maintaining accurate documentation, and helping coordinate patient services while promoting a safe and patient-centered environment. Minimum Qualifications High School Diploma or equivalent required. Completion of an accredited Medical Assistant program.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) or Registered Medical Assistant (RMA) credential required. Current CPR/BLS certification. Strong understanding of medical terminology, clinical procedures, and documentation standards. Ability to multitask in a fast-paced environment while maintaining attention to detail. Excellent verbal and written communication skills. Compassionate, patient-focused, and able to work effectively with diverse populations. Proficient in Electronic Health Records (EHR) systems and general office technology. Ability to maintain confidentiality and comply with HIPAA regulations. Additional Considerations Prior clinical experience in an outpatient, primary care, or specialty setting is preferred. Background Investigation Requirements:
All applicants are subject to a background investigation. Investigations may include fingerprint checks (State Police, FBI); local agency checks; employment verification; verification of education (relevant to employment); credit checks; and other checks based on the position.
Drug Testing Requirements:
Applicants applying to a designated safety sensitive position are subject to a pre-employment drug screen. Marijuana use is prohibited for positions that require possession of a firearm or a Commercial Driver's License in the performance of official duties such as Corrections Officers, Probation Officers, Tractor Trailer Drivers and others.
